Top 5 Carpooling and Ridesharing Apps on Android in the Middle East for Q4 2021
A detailed look at the performance of the top 5 carpooling and ridesharing apps on the Android platform in the Middle East during the fourth quarter of 2021.
The fourth quarter of 2021 saw varied performance metrics for the top 5 carpooling and ridesharing apps on the Android platform in the Middle East. Here’s a closer look at the trends in weekly downloads and active users for these apps.
Uber - Request a ride experienced a steady number of weekly downloads, peaking at 26K in the week of November 29. The active users fluctuated slightly, starting at 625K and peaking at around 705K in mid-December before ending the quarter at approximately 639K.
Careem – rides, food & more saw consistent weekly downloads, hitting a high of 23K in the last week of October. The number of active users reached its peak at 383K in early November but gradually declined to around 337K by the end of December.
Bolt: Request a Ride had a modest but steady number of weekly downloads, with a peak of 14K in early October. The active user base remained stable, hovering around 35K to 40K throughout the quarter.
Uber - Driver: Drive & Deliver maintained a steady download rate, with weekly downloads ranging between 7K and 8K. The active users showed a slight upward trend, starting at 19K and ending the quarter at approximately 20K.
Jeeny - جيني saw a significant increase in weekly downloads towards the end of the quarter, peaking at around 7.5K in the last week of December. Active users increased from 28K in early October to around 31K in early December, before settling at approximately 29K by the end of the year.
